Rabbitohs coach Jason Demetriou says celebrity fullback Latrell Mitchell must inject himself into the competition from the outset after a sluggish begin got here again to chew the Bunnies on Friday evening.

Souths have been off the tempo within the first half towards a Storm aspect that dug deep in defence and stifled the hosts on the sting though the Rabbitohs loved 67 per cent of the territory.

Demetriou lamented his aspect’s defensive lapses within the 18-10 loss, however it was their assault which actually struggled contained in the pink zone.

Mitchell got here to life with a strive help, 81 metres and 5 sort out busts within the second half, however he was just about unsighted within the opening 40 minutes, making simply 27 metres from three carries as the gang begged him to get extra concerned.

“He most likely wants to search out his approach into the sport a bit earlier,” Demetriou mentioned.

“I assumed the backend of the primary half he began to get himself into the sport a bit extra.

“I assumed throughout the board we have been off the tempo a little bit bit. Once we all began getting on the tempo and enjoying like we are able to, the scoreboard strain bought the higher of us.”

The loss leaves the Rabbitohs with simply two wins from the opening 5 rounds with a giant sport towards the Bulldogs on Good Friday arising.

The strain shall be on Mitchell, Cody Walker and Damien Cook dinner to handle the attacking woes, however the gifted trio want extra from their massive males to create some kind of platform.

Solely two South Sydney forwards ran for greater than 100 metres in comparison with the Storm who had all 5 beginning forwards crack triple digits.

The Rabbitohs can level to the truth that Jai Arrow, Junior Tatola, Siliva Havili, Liam Knight and Shaquai Mitchell are all injured, however the issue is none of them are more likely to be slot in time for subsequent week’s sport at Accor Stadium.

And to make issues worse, Alex Johnston seems set to overlook the match after he got here off late in Friday’s loss having banged his head on the turf making an attempt to attain within the nook.

“I feel Jai and Junior are one other week so these guys who performed tonight are just about going to must be the blokes who strip up subsequent week,” Demetriou mentioned.

“We’ve simply bought to be sincere with ourselves when it comes to how we strategy the sport and get ourselves in the correct mindset.

“It doesn’t matter who you play within the NRL – when you don’t flip as much as begin the sport then you definately’re going to be on the again foot and then you definately’re going to be enjoying catch up.”
